Divorce laws vary from state to state. Some states use a "no fault" divorce rule meaning that when one spouse files for divorce, they do not commonly need to do anything beyond demonstrating that the couple has irreconcilable differences.

A "fault" based state on the other hand needs a reason for divorce such as adultery or abuse.
